Costs affect both totals
In our eight-trade example, positive gross results total USD 550 and negative results total −USD 400. Gross profit factor is 1.375. After USD 5 in costs per trade, positive results total USD 530 and negative results total −USD 420. Net profit factor is approximately 1.262.
Do not subtract total fees from winning results alone. Fees can even turn a small winner into a losing trade. To calculate net profit factor, first calculate every trade after costs and then assign it to the appropriate total.
What the number does not describe
A ratio above one means a positive balance for the recorded series on the chosen cost basis. It does not describe sequence, drawdown, committed capital or the number of independent decisions. A handful of trades can produce a very high and unstable value.
The zero-loss case
With zero losing results, there is no finite quotient. Show “no losing trades” together with sample size. If both totals are zero, there is no meaningful result basis. A calculator should explain these cases instead of inventing a replacement number.
Profit factor = sum of positive results / |sum of negative results|
A reproducible example
| Measure | Before costs | After costs |
|---|---|---|
| Sum of winning trades (USD) | 550.00 | 530.00 |
| Absolute sum of losing trades (USD) | 400.00 | 420.00 |
| Balance: wins minus losses (USD) | 150.00 | 110.00 |
| Profit Factor | 1.375 | 1.262 |
USD 550 in wins − USD 400 in losses = USD 150 balance before costs. After 8 × USD 5 in costs, USD 110 remains. Net profit factor first deducts costs from each trade: 530 / 420 ≈ 1.262.

Frequently asked questions
What is a good profit factor?
There is no universal target. Assess the period, sample size, costs, drawdown and stability of the underlying series together.
